Follow the steps described below to perform verification and calibration.
1.
Let the instrument operate for at least 1 hour before performing the verification
and/or calibration.
2.
Run the service program (ref. Section 4.1 for start-up).
3.
Check that the fixed temperature and pressure settings are correct, or that the
PLC inputs for the gas temperature and pressure are correct (i.e. set to
calibration conditions).
4.
Introduce the calibration gas into the cell. Wait until the system reaches stable
levels.
5.
Check if the reading is in agreement with the concentration of the certified gas.
If required, perform calibration (PROPORTIONAL or GLOBAL) as described in
Section 4.3.7.
6.
Save the instrument settings to a file as described in Section 4.3.9.
7.
If applicable re-set the pressure and temperature parameters to process
conditions (ref. Section 4.3.5).
8.
The calibration is completed and the monitor can be used for measurement.
Note that when gas is flushed through the cell, the cell pressure is higher than the
ambient pressure. The pressure difference depends on the flow rate and the
diameter and length of the outlet tubes. It is therefore highly recommended to
measure the gas pressure close to the cell, using an absolute pressure sensor in
order to provide the instrument with correct gas pressure during the verification and
calibration procedure. If only the ambient pressure is known or the pressure sensor is
located far away from the cell, one can switch off the gas flow before calibration, wait
1 minute for the readings to stabilise and subsequently perform calibration. In this
case the gas pressure is equal to the ambient pressure.
